Nishida, R. and Acree, T.E. 1984.
Isolation and characterization of methyl epijasmonate from lemon (Citrus limon Burm.).
J. Agric. Food Chem 32(5): 1001-3.
Two epimers of Me 2-[2-Z-pentenyl]-3-oxocyclopentane-1-acetate, i.e., Me jasmonate (I) and Me epijasmonate (II), were isolated from lemon peel (C. limon). 1H NMR, mass spectra, hydrogenation, ozonolysis, and acid catalyzed isomerization were used to establish their identity. Gas chromatog. indicated the presence of 75 .mu.g of Me jasmonate isomers in the peel of 1 lemon with >95% of it in the thermodynamically less stable Me epijasmonate form.
